New "SuperGreen" Energy Efficiency

YHC has developed innovative building techniques and designs to drastically improve the overall efficiency on new homes. This means much lower heating bills (such as 20% of the cost of heating a new Yukon house with the usual 2x6 walls!).

Oil Tank Installations to meet new Code as of April 1st, 2009

Residential fuel oil tanks will be required to meet new Building Code standards to reduce the chance of tipping over due to ground settling and/or Earthquake effects.
